mySaúde Açores app now provides test results
location Angra do Heroísmo

Secretaria Regional da Saúde e Segurança Social

Since Monday, the results of clinical tests carried out from this date, 21 July, are now available on the mySaúde Açores app.

By accessing the "user documents" tab, users can quickly access their results on their mobile phone without needing to visit the health centre where the tests were carried out.

Also starting this week, information related to appointments, including bookings, cancellations, rescheduling and reminders, will now be sent via text message, sent from “mySaude.” Users who have the mySaúde Açores app will receive a notification 48 hours before their scheduled appointment and will only receive a text message reminder if they do not open the app within two hours.

The new system covers all Regional Health Service users, whether or not registered with mySaúde Açores. It applies to consultations at health centres on all islands and the Terceira and Horta hospitals.

The Divino Espírito Santo Hospital, in São Miguel, will be included when it is integrated into mySaúde Açores, on a date to be announced shortly.

The Regional Secretariat for Health and Social Security clarifies that previous methods of communication, such as telephone calls and letters, may still be used in specific cases of users who have difficulty using mobile devices and suggests that, in these cases, the accounts of these users be managed by other family members through the mySaúde Açores app.

The app also features a new "dashboard" tab. It allows users to update their health data, such as blood pressure, weight, heart rate and blood sugar levels, so that it can be included in their medical records in the future, thus facilitating communication between users and their doctors as well as monitoring their progress and evolution.
